Dating back to the early 1800’s, Reclaimed Hemlock planks are restored from century-old barns that represented the ingenuity and integrity of the early settlers. With coloration ranging from amber to deep malt brown, Hemlock’s distinct grain and wagon wheel knots amplify a naturally distressed look that radiates a warm and enduring character.

Trailhead is created by planing and brushing the surface of old hemlock barn material and applying dark pigments and Hardwax Oil to bring out a dark richness, and rustic feel.
